Hi, it seems like this should be simple, but I don't have the instruction manual on the T20 I bought used a few years back. I need to replace a corrupt hard drive. I've located where it is, removed a little thingie exposing the end of it, but I have no idea how to extract the it from the laptop. There doesn't seem to be anything obvious to grab onto. Here is the PDF version of the T2x series Hardware Maintenance Manual. The only thing that holds the HDD in place is the friction of the pins and a single screw in the plastic cover.

There's a raised line in the plastic that extends from the screw hole to the opposite end of the hard drive cover. You are supposed to use your fingernails to pull the drive out. For me, I've found that it's easier to use both thumbs to lift up on the cover. If it's really hard to remove, slide a flat-bladed screwdriver between the cover and the base and then twist. If somebody used the wrong screws on the caddy, the drive will not slide out all that easily.
http://www.kawakami-ca.com/images/t2x_hd_removal.jpg
And yes, the lid of the system needs to be open!
